In 2020-2021, allied health professions students earned 1,125 degrees and certificates from a Massachusetts school, making the subject the 5th in the state.

Our analysis looked at 11 schools in Massachusetts to see which basic certificate programs were the most popular for healthcare students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Allied Health Professions program at each school on the list.

Our 2023 rankings named Bunker Hill Community College the most popular school in Massachusetts for allied health professions students working on their basic certificate. Located in the large city of Boston, BHCC is a public school with a medium-sized student population.
About 74% of the students majoring in allied health at the school are women while 26% are male.
